The combination has to have simply enough water to ensure that each accumulation particle is totally surrounded by the cement paste, that the rooms in between the aggregate are filled up, and that the concrete is liquid sufficient to be put and spread successfully. An additional resilience element is the amount of concrete in connection with the aggregate (revealed as a three-part ratio-- cement to great aggregate to coarse aggregate). Where specifically solid concrete is required, there will be fairly less accumulation. Layout mix ratios are decided by an engineer after evaluating the residential properties of the specific components being made use of. Design-mix concrete can have really broad specifications that can not be consulted with even more fundamental nominal mixes, however the involvement of the designer typically boosts the cost of the concrete mix.

Foam concrete, additionally known as light-weight mobile concrete or foamed cement, is a cement-based product that integrates steady air bubbles to create a light-weight and highly protecting item. Foam concrete offers outstanding thermal and acoustic insulation residential properties, making it ideal for applications such as insulation, void filling, and trench reinstatement. Its lightweight nature also makes it much easier to handle and transport compared to conventional concrete. Foam concrete can be quickly built into different shapes and sizes, enabling versatile applications. Its residential properties make it appropriate for insulation, gap filling, and other building applications where weight decrease and thermal insulation are preferred. The Pantheon has exterior foundation wall surfaces that are 26 http://shanetgxk849.theburnward.com/expert-concrete-contractors-for-driveways-patios-and-walkways-concrete-driveways feet vast and 15 feet deep and made from pozzolana cement (lime, responsive volcanic sand and water) tamped down over a layer of thick stone aggregate. Resolving and movement over almost 2,000 years, in addition to occasional earthquakes, have produced fractures that would generally have compromised the framework sufficient that, now, it must have dropped. The exterior walls that support the dome consist of 7 equally spaced particular niches with chambers between them that include the outside. These niches and chambers, originally developed only to decrease the weight of the framework, are thinner than the main portions of the wall surfaces and work as control joints that regulate crack areas. Stresses brought on by movement are relieved by breaking in the specific niches and chambers. This indicates that the dome is basically supported by 16 thick, structurally audio concrete columns developed by the parts of the exterior walls between the specific niches and chambers.

Scientists from MIT and other institutions have actually uncovered an active ingredient called quicklime used in ancient Roman strategies for producing concrete that may have offered the product self-healing residential or commercial properties, reports Jacklin Kwan for Scientific Research Magazine. When the scientists made their very own Roman concrete and evaluated to see how it took care of splits, "the lime swellings liquified and recrystallized, effectively completing the cracks and keeping the concrete solid," Kwan describes.
This product can then react with water, developing a calcium-saturated option, which can recrystallize as calcium carbonate and swiftly load the fracture, or react with pozzolanic materials to more enhance the composite product. These responses occur automatically and consequently instantly heal the cracks prior to they spread out. Previous assistance for this theory was discovered through the assessment of other Roman concrete samples that exhibited calcite-filled splits.
